“This is Lotte's declaration of entering the Mokdong business.”
At a press conference held on September 14 at the 'L'Ell Mokdong Lounge' in Yangcheon-gu, Seoul, a Lotte Construction official explained the significance of the lounge's opening. Although no construction rights have been secured among the 14 complexes in the Mokdong new town, the company announced its intention to actively participate in the reconstruction market, estimated at around 30 trillion won.
The lounge features landscaping reminiscent of a forest and smooth, curved spaces. Inside, works by artists Kim Whanki and Kim Chang-yeol are displayed, while a separate area showcases media art reinterpreting works by Monet and Van Gogh. The space emphasizes nature and art over housing types and finishing materials, presenting the high-end brand 'L'Ell' residential concept.
Lotte Construction has established lounges near the Omokgyo Station in eastern Mokdong and near the academy district in western Sinjeong-dong. This strategy aims to promote the brand to the existing 26,629 households in Mokdong new town and expand its bidding base ahead of the selection of construction companies.

Focusing on Complexes 2, 7, 11, and 14… “We will actively bid if competition arises”
Lotte Construction is particularly targeting complexes 2, 7, 11, and 14 in Mokdong. However, the company is not limiting its bidding to these complexes and is open to opportunities across all 14 complexes.
Kang Young-soo, head of Lotte Construction's Urban Maintenance Team, stated, “The complexes we are currently targeting have not yet announced bidding notices, so it is difficult to specify which complexes we will participate in,” but added, “We are focusing on complexes 2, 7, 11, and 14.”
He continued, “We will strategically decide on participation based on a comprehensive review of each project's profitability, conditions for advancement, and competitive environment,” emphasizing, “If competition arises with other companies, we will actively pursue bids.”
The card Lotte Construction is playing for the Mokdong bidding is the 'Sorbonne Project.' This is not a specific complex name but a residential concept aimed at all complexes from 1 to 14 in Mokdong. The plan is to combine Mokdong's educational and natural environment with culture and art, and once specific complexes are determined, collaborate with overseas design firms to reflect the characteristics of each site.
Kwon Dong-hyuk, head of Lotte Construction's Urban Maintenance Team, explained, “We started with two questions: What is the important value Mokdong has built over the past 40 years, and what kind of city should Mokdong become after reconstruction?” He added, “The Sorbonne Project aims to enhance Mokdong's education and greenery with the intellect and art of Paris.”

Differentiating through Education and Cultural Services… Specifics to be Defined During Bidding
Lotte Construction believes that competition in high-end housing will expand from exterior design and high-quality finishing materials to education, culture, and services after residents move in. The lounge also reflects this direction through its art pieces and spatial composition.
The company is considering large libraries, book cafes, and learning spaces, and is pursuing collaboration with Lotte Group affiliates. Discussions are underway to introduce hotel-style services from Lotte Hotel Signiel, as well as integrating cultural programs from the Lotte Cultural Foundation and distribution and logistics services from Lotte Shopping and Lotte Mart.
Kwon emphasized, “The value of high-end apartments will no longer be determined solely by how extravagant the exterior is, how large the community is, or what finishing materials are used,” stating, “Connecting education, art, culture, nature, wellness, and technology services into a single lifestyle is our vision for a new residential culture.”
However, the details disclosed on this day are common plans for the Mokdong bidding. Specific educational programs, designs for each complex, and financial conditions for actual bidding proposals have not yet been revealed. Lotte Construction plans to refine its proposals in line with the bidding timeline, considering the varying profitability of each complex and the strategies of competitors.
Regarding shared costs, Kwon noted, “The 14 complexes in Mokdong each have different profitability,” adding, “Our goal is to create the best complexes by enhancing Lotte Construction's capabilities within the defined resources and maximizing future sale prices.” He also stated that they would ensure competitive financial conditions compared to other complexes.
